PAWS is a nonprofit and no-kill animal rescue that aims to help people foster and adopt companion animals. This organization handles the medical care of injured or sick animals as well as provides dogs, cats, and other animals with spaying and neutering services.

PAWS consists of volunteers as well as a Board of Volunteer Directors. The adoption process at PAWS is rather detailed and complex. This is to ensure the pets are safe in their new homes. 

Adoption includes filling out an adoption application, undergoing an interview with an adoption specialist, and visiting the foster home where the cat or dog is currently living and given foster care. All PAWS animals receive spaying or neutering assistance, testing, and vaccination before adoption.

Lake Humane Society is a nonprofit organization dedicated to protecting animals in Lake County, Ohio. This organization was founded in 1937 and has since built thousands of connections between pets and their owners. Every year, volunteers at Lake Humane Society provide care and plenty of love to approximately 1,200 animals.

This center does not receive any government funding and is run solely on donations and volunteers to provide care for pets. The Lake Humane Society provides microchipping to all of their dogs and cats along with health care like ear tipping, spaying, and neutering services to cats in the community. 

For an extra charge, pet owners can receive the following services:

  • Rabies vaccination
  • FVCRP vaccine
  • FeLV/FIV Snap test
  • Topical flea treatment
  • Tapeworm injection

This organization aims to protect dogs and citizens in their community. Its mission is to provide compassionate treatment and care toward dogs. The Franklin County Dog Shelter and Adoption Center provides vet care to dogs and unwanted animals.

Lost dogs are reunited with their owners through this organization as well. The dog shelter also sells dog licenses for new owners. Most importantly, this organization finds forever homes for more than 4,000 dogs every year.

To rescue a puppy, especially a Yorkie, get in touch with the Save A Yorkie Rescue. You can pursue the adoption process to bring a Yorkshire Terrier into your family. 

The first step is to fill out an adoption application, which volunteers then review to find you the perfect match. The next step is a reference check with a veterinarian to learn about the vetting care of your prior pets.

The next step is a phone interview and the last step before the adoption is having a volunteer over for a home visit.

This is a rescue helping find forever homes for Yorkshire Terrier dogs. This is a small nonprofit organization located in Lorain, Ohio. The volunteers here aim to find good and loving forever families for their Yorkie pooches.

This organization provides essential veterinarian care, grooming, and safety for their small breed dogs. The entire enterprise depends on donations and volunteers to help it run. 

The foundation takes in as many Yorkshire Terriers and mixed Yorkie breeds as they can and provides them with essential foster care and rehabilitation before finding them forever homes.

How Much Adopting a Rescue Costs

Cost word after a stack of coins

The cost of adopting a rescue dog varies greatly depending on the shelter you’ve chosen. Shelters have fees ranging anywhere from $50 to $350 or more. These costs may grow higher if you live in an area with an elevated cost of living. 

Dog adoption fees often include a variety of services like vaccinations, a wellness exam, deworming, spaying or neutering, microchips, and preventive heartworm treatment.

You’ll also need to consider veterinary costs, which may be higher if you live in a large city versus a small town. Furthermore, you should cover the costs of toys, a crate, leash and collar, food and water bowls, training pads, treats, and dog food.

How to Get Approved for Adoption

There are several steps you can take to get approved when trying to adopt a dog, such as:

  • Add a fence to your backyard or front yard
  • Research the breed you’re looking to adopt and make sure to meet all of the dog breed’s requirements
  • Choose a veterinarian for the puppy as well as a dog trainer
  • Schedule time to meet the dog you’re interested in before sending in your application
  • Ask the rescue shelter plenty of questions to show how committed you are
  • Provide a good amount of details when filling out your dog adoption application

Tips for Taking Care of Rescue Dogs

Tips For (New) Pet Owners

Some of the advice out there for handling rescue dogs is similar to dogs from breeders or other situations. First, you should take the dog to a veterinarian to get a full check-up exam.

Next, take your pup to a dog training session based on positive reinforcement. This can help you learn how to train your dog and get the canine ready to follow directions.

Any other pets in the home should be introduced one at a time so that the dog gets used to them slowly. Lastly, try to keep the food the same as the one the pup was eating previously.
